Job Description

This role will be in charge of post sales customer relations for a large Telecommunications Corporation. He/She is the single point of contact for all activity during the implementation phase to install. They effectively own the contract compliance and is ultimately responsible for the implementation, lifecycle management, and profitability of the customer contract. The Federal Program Manager is the advocate for the customer within the Federal Government sales channel.

This individual will be required to interface with all aspects of the company that service the contract and the customer (i.e. Sales, Service Delivery, Service Assurance, Network Engineering, Solution Engineering, Finance, Billing, Legal, IT/IS etc.).

Essential Duties
  • Deliver on all program requirements including technical, cost, schedule, and quality performance that could involve cost overruns and deficiencies.
  • Successfully service delivery across all program areas to ensure it follows a well-defined and detailed work scope, schedule, and budget.
  • Integrate various activities and task areas to ensure effective client support.
  • Manage resources across projects, and maintain/track contract deliverables, schedule, and budget.
  • Recommends changes to improve processes and alleviate process inaccuracy and duplication.
  • Ensure conformity to contractual obligations; establish and maintain technical and financial reports to show program progress.
  • Ensure appropriate management, customer and supplier involvement throughout the life of the program.
  • Formulate and enforce work standards, subcontractor management and performance, and customer satisfaction and alignment of these with the objectives of a program.
  • Within this role the Program Manager will serve as a Customer advocate and will ensure that customers are receiving proper customer service, on time delivery for their contractors and meeting customer deliverables, handling day 2 support when it comes to billing or outages.

Job Requirements
  • Bachelor’s Degree or Equivalent experience needed (MBA Preferred)
  • Secret Clearance is Preferred - or must be eligible and open to obtain a Secret Clearance
  • Previous experience in a Telecom (MSO, CLEC, IXC, RBOC, Wireless etc.) environment focused on Federal Government Customer Programs and Project Coordinator
  • Experience working Cross functionally with other teams in a highly matrixed organizations
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ills, including presentations to management.
  • Engineering Process and Design documentation experience
  • Experience writing and developing implementation plans in support of complicated Federal Government networks
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Project, Visio, PowerPoint, and Microsoft Word, Smartsheets
  • Consistent exercise of independent judgment and discretion in matters of significance.
